About this Event

A screening and reading programme with Komtouch Napattalong, Kaisa Saarinen, and Bart Seng Wen Long, which extends out from the trio’s collective installation, bringing focus to their distinct yet sympathetic forms of narration and storytelling.

In collaboration with Prince Claus Fund.

Komtouch Napattaloong (he/him) is a visual artist and filmmaker based in Thailand. Working across experimental, documentary, and “post-documentary” cinematic forms, his practice involves identity deconstructions, migration narratives, and historical translations to examine the nature of memory, displacement, and image agency.

Kaisa Saarinen (she/her) is a Finnish researcher, poet, and novelist based in London. She writes about false dichotomies, country girls lost in the dazzle of big cities and other underdogs, strange desires and painful transformations, with particular attention to the absurd pleasures and frequent horrors of living through an ongoing apocalypse. Together with Bart Seng Wen Long, she is leading the Rubber Dreams of its Lifetime project.

Bart Seng Wen Long (he/him) is a Singaporean artist, filmmaker and curator based in London. His practice spans moving images, photography, expanded cinema and performance, revolving around confrontations between reality and fantasy, and how in the heat of such encounters, they reveal the interconnectedness of things within the political economy of desire.
